[00:13.00]The Presence 1 Of My Brother
[00:18.32]我哥哥的鬼魂
[00:32.70]She jumped into my bed
[00:34.76]and I lay down on the little futon that I had in my room,
[00:38.84]covered with blankets, curled 2 up like a ball, scared to death.
[00:44.53]After trying to calm me down by talking to me,
[00:47.68]she turned off the light, and as soon as she did,
[00:51.78]the light came back,
[00:53.56]flashing in front of me like it was inspecting me,
[00:57.13]mocking me, I don't know.
[00:59.59]I was so scared that I put my head underneath 3 my blanket,
[01:03.90]started to cry and told my sister that it was back again.
[01:08.58]All she could say was:
[01:10.10]Yes, I feel it too, close your eyes and try to go to sleep,
[01:15.62]it won't harm you. Easier said than done, I was terrified.
[01:21.98]But fatigue 4 started to sink in
[01:24.12]and before I knew it was morning.
[01:27.71]I was embarrassed to talk about it,
[01:30.23]because like I said, I'm a down to earth kind of person,
[01:35.20]and I didn't believe in ghosts,
[01:37.71]but my opinion has changed since that night.
[01:41.02]I'm not sure if it was my brother that visited me that night,
[01:46.20]and I don't think I want to know.
[01:48.90]I'm just very glad that ever since that happened,
[01:51.73]I never had an experience like that again.
